VIDEO: Referee #Darren Drysdale squares up to Ipswich Town’s #AlanJudge Referee #DarrenDrysdale locked heads with Ipswich midfielder Alan Judge in an extraordinary exchange during their goalless League One draw with #Northampton. The official moved his head towards the Irishman in the final moments of the match and then briefly appeared to square up to the 32-year-old, before being ushered away by Northampton's Lloyd Jones. Judge, who had protested after being penalised for simulation, was then shown a yellow card, the fifth booking of the match. In the third minute of stoppage time, Town's Flynn Downes was sent off for violent conduct in an ugly end to the match. Lowly Northampton defied the odds to secure a draw, but will be frustrated they only came away with one point instead of all three. It lifted the Cobblers up two places, but they remain inside the relegation zone on goal difference. Ipswich, who finished with 10 men, moved up a place to 11th but are four points off the top six. Ipswich keeper Tomas Holy had to gather a shot from Sam Hoskins and then hack clear after Troy Parrott's loose pass was seized on by Mark Marshall. Holy smothered Jack Sowerby's effort and Luke Matheson blocked an effort by Hoskins while, with the half drawing to a close, Peter Kioso hit the post and Marshall pulled his shot wide. Video: Ngozi Okonjo-iweala discusses Women's Empowerment Inequality Issues on CNN Former Nigerian finance minister and current World Trade Organization soon to be Director-General Ngozi Okonjo-Iweala join CNN in a conversation to discuss women’s empowerment. "For every gendered situation, it's so much [more] so for women of color," says Nigeria's Ngozi Okonjo-Iweala, who’s set to become the next head of the WTO. "Things have improved, both within my continent and also worldwide. But the issue is that the pace of change is too slow." She goes further to explain the inequality issues women face adding that, “we need to talk to men in order to change things. It’s not good enough to just talk to ourselves as women. So the book is also for men because men can take action to improve things.” Meanwhile, Three months after the Trump administration rejected her, former Nigerian finance minister Ngozi Okonjo-Iweala is set to receive unanimous backing on Monday to become the first woman and first African director-general of the World Trade Organization. A self-declared “doer” with a track record of taking on seemingly intractable problems, Okonjo-Iweala will have her work cut out for her at the trade body, even with Donald Trump, who had threatened to pull the United States out of the organisation, no longer in the White House. As director-general, a position that wields limited formal power, Okonjo-Iweala, 66, will need to broker international trade talks in the face of persistent U.S.-China conflict; respond to pressure to reform trade rules; and counter protectionism heightened by the COVID-19 pandemic. A 25-year veteran of the World Bank, where she oversaw an $81 billion portfolio, Okonjo-Iweala ran against seven other candidates by espousing a belief in trade’s ability to lift people out of poverty. She studied development economics at Harvard after experiencing civil war in Nigeria as a teenager. She returned to the country in 2003 to serve as finance minister and backers point to her hard-nose negotiating skills that helped seal a deal to cancel billions of dollars of Nigerian debt with the Paris Club of creditor nations in 2005. “She brings stature, she brings experience, a network and a temperament of trying to get things done, which is quite a welcome lot in my view,” former WTO chief Pascal Lamy told Reuters. “I think she’s a good choice.” Key to her success will be her ability to operate in the centre of a “U.S.-EU-China triangle”, he said. Video: Usman pummels Burns to win TKO and retain his welterweight world title #KamaruUsman defeats #Gilbert Burns by #TKO to retain #UFCwelterweight title Kamaru Usman and Gilbert Burns were full of emotion while embracing in the middle of the Octagon on Saturday night. Burns had blood and tears running down his face. Some of their cornermen behind them were trying not to cry. Usman stopped Burns, his former teammate, via TKO at 34 seconds in the third round to defend his UFC welterweight title in the main event of UFC 258 in Las Vegas. Usman landed a right hand as he was switching stances to floor Burns, then slammed Burns with punches on the ground until referee Herb Dean pulled him off. "Gilbert is a guy that I've known from the start," Usman said in his postfight interview. "I love him. This one was tough for me to deal with." Usman picked up his 13th straight win, surpassing legend Georges St-Pierre for the most consecutive wins in UFC welterweight history. Only Anderson Silva has won more than 13 straight fights in UFC history, winning 16 in a row from 2006 to 2012. Usman is tied with six other fighters with 13 consecutive wins. Usman and Burns were teammates in South Florida since 2012, first with the Blackzilians and most recently with Sanford MMA. Usman departed for Colorado to train under coach Trevor Wittman last year after the initial fight with Burns was scheduled for July. But Burns tested positive for COVID-19 and withdrew from that bout. Henri Hooft, the longtime head coach for both Usman and Burns, did not corner either man and said he would not even watch the fight. Usman said he "almost started bawling" when the two fighters embraced in the Octagon after the fight. "I know what that loss feels like," he said. "I have a loss on my record. I'm not perfect. I know what that felt like. I knew how bad he wanted this. ... Having to be the one to do that to him, it almost broke me in there." The bout had major implications outside of the personal story. Coming in, ESPN had Usman ranked No. 5 in the world in its pound-for-pound MMA rankings. In the welterweight division, ESPN has Usman ranked No. 1 and Burns at No. 5. Burns rocked Usman twice early with huge right hands. But Usman hung in through a tumultuous first round. He then took over in the second, working a beautiful jab and stymieing Burns' power and explosiveness. Usman's striking looked better than ever, as he switched stances and landed with power from each one. In the second round, Usman dropped Burns twice, the second time with a jab. In the third, it was a right hand that resembled a jab that put Burns on his butt before Usman pounced and finished on the ground. Usman outlanded Burns 83-45 in significant strikes, per UFC Stats. "I am the best on the planet for a reason," Usman said in his postfight interview. "Y'all, everybody else, you better put some f---ing respect on my name. ... I'm here to stay." Burns said he made a "mistake" trying to finish Usman in the opening round. "I know I can end any one of these guys. But in order to become a champion, I have to be disciplined," Burns said. "I saw he was hurt. I kind of started loading up so much [on my punches]. The key for me was to keep doing what I was doing. Stay light on my feet. ... Me, I was overexcited. He stayed disciplined. That's what happened." UFC 258 was held with COVID-19 protocols in place at the UFC Apex, a facility across from the UFC's Las Vegas corporate campus. It was the promotion's first domestic pay-per-view card of the year. Usman (18-1) has been champion since beating Tyron Woodley at UFC 235 in March 2019. He has had three successful title defenses. The Nigeria native, who grew up in Texas, has never lost in the UFC. "He's the whole package," UFC president Dana White said. "The guy's got the whole thing. It's just, when are people gonna notice?" White added: "The kid is the real deal, man. For the people that know, for the people that actually know about fighting, they know this win tonight was a big deal." Usman, 33, was coming off a unanimous-decision win over Jorge Masvidal at UFC 251 last July. Afterward, Usman called out Masvidal, who took that fight on six days' notice. Usman said that "it's not done" with Masvidal. "He keeps running his mouth," Usman said. "If he's gonna talk, step in here and see me." White said Usman has "a lot of options," but if Usman and Masvidal want to fight -- and if the fans are interested -- White said the promotion would consider it. "If you look at all the guys that are lined up that he has to fight next, and he keeps doing what he's doing, we're gonna all pop our heads up one day and we're gonna start talking GOAT," White said. "It's not just how you're fighting and if you're winning, it's who you're fighting, too." #OccupyLekkiTollGate: Macaroni, has been arrested at the Lekki Tollgate (VIDEO) Mr. Macaroni was arrested by men from the Nigerian Force. He was arrested at the Lekki Toll Gate as he went out to join the #OccupyLekkiTollGate protest that is being staged by Nigerians. The protest is being staged because Nigerians feel the Lekki Toll Gate shouldn’t be opened since all investigations on the Lekki Toll Gate massacre hasn’t been concluded. It could be recalled that on October 20, there was a shoot-out which led to the death of many innocent Nigerians who were part of the #EndSARS protests. Investigations were made however, these investigations were not conclude and the perpetrators are walking free. VIDEO: GOVERNORS STILL SIDELINED IN THE AFFAIRS OF NDDC SAYS GOVERNOR WIKE Rivers State governor, Nyesom Ezenwo Wike, says despite the inauguration of the advisory council of the Niger Delta Development Commission (NDDC), oil producing state governors are still sidelined in the affairs of the intervention agency. The governor noted that because the governing party dictates what happens in the NDDC, the commission now acts like a state on its own and refusing to interface with the Governors of the oil producing States to strategically develop the Niger Delta region. He stated this when members of the House of Representatives Committee on NDDC led by its chairman, Hon (Dr.) Olubunmi Tunji-Ojo paid him a courtesy visit at the Government House, Port Harcourt on Thursday. Governor Wike explained that contrary to assumption that governors of the Niger Delta are critical stakeholders in the affairs of the NDDC, they are not in the true sense of it. According to him, since the inauguration of the NDDC advisory council last year, the present federal government has ensured that the governors are sidelined in the affairs of the commission. “Even when we are inaugurated, we were not involved in anything that happens in NDDC. Which is most unfortunate.” He further continued: "NDDC is like a state on its own without working with the State government and why is it so. It is so because the states of NDDC are controlled by the opposition party therefore there is no need to consult with them." The governor explained that in a bid to ensure NDDC does not embark on indiscriminate execution of projects that often distort the state developmental agenda, the Rivers State government recently obtained a court order that prohibits the commission from carrying out projects without the consent of the state government. Governor Wike urged the National Assembly to be resolute in its oversight function by ensuring that the NDDC stops frittering the resources meant for the development of the Niger Delta region on building roads in Army barracks, police stations and spending Billions of Naira to ensure he did not win election. The governor stated that NDDC and the Rivers State had once agreed to collaborate on a legacy project, but the commission ended up defrauding the State government "NDDC fraudulently duped us over the Mother and Child hospital. They duped us. They had an agreement with the State government to build a regional hospital called Mother and Child hospital. They agreed that it will be N1.7 Billion Naira. State government to bring N800million, they will bring N900 million. State government at that time paid their N800million. NDDC mobilised the contractor with N400 million of the N800 million we brought and then abandoned the contractor and the contractor left site. And when we came on board, we said okay, we don't want to partner with you again, give us back our N400 million , it became a problem. Politics came in. " The governor said he will continually speak out for the interest of the people of Rivers state. According to him, within one year, he has awarded contracts for construction of eight flyovers and on Wednesday approved over N16 billion for the development of critical infrastructure in the Rivers state University. "I want the best for my people. They have given me everything in life, so I owe them. It is not what I will make, they have already made me. So what do I offer back.” He urged the National Assembly to ensure that planned amendment of the Electoral Act will usher in a new era of free and fair elections. He insisted that, “there cannot be development without good governance. There cannot be good governance without the rule of law. Watch Rony’s hilarious missed penalty after mixing #BrunoFernandes AND Neymar’s techniques Watch Palmeiras ace Rony’s hilarious penalty miss at Club World Cup as he mixes Bruno Fernandes AND Neymar’s techniques PALMEIRAS star #Rony left fans in hysterics as he produced 'one of the worst penalties' ever seen. The #ClubWorldCup bronze-medal clash against Al Ahly SC went to penalties after extra-time finished 0-0 on Thursday. Three Palmeiras' players missed from 12 yards - but Rony's was far and away the worst of the lot. He tried to combine techniques used by the likes of #Neymar, Bruno #Fernandes and Paul Pogba. But the 25-year-old failed miserably before his team eventually lost the shoot-out and missed out on third place at the tournament. Rony looked full of confidence as he waited a long time before starting his run-up from outside of the box. He sprinted towards the ball then slowed the right down in a bid to trick the keeper. Pogba famously used this technique when he scored from the spot against Leicester in 2018. After eight seconds, his stuttered run-up was complete and he pulled the trigger. He channelled his inner Fernandes as he jumped just before he struck the ball. But Al Ahly #goalkeeper Mohamed El Shenawi easily saved the shocking strike. After the match, a clip of Rony's overly ambitious penalty went viral on #Twitter. One fan said: "Rony for #Palmeiras has just taken one of the worst penalties I've seen in a long time. Looked like he was drunk." Another added: "Palmeiras can you teach your players how to kick a penalty? What is this?" On February 9, United States President Joe Biden had issued a presidential memorandum aimed at expanding protection of the rights of lesbian, gay, bisexual, transgender and queer, and intersex people worldwide, including potentially through the use of financial sanctions. Despite international pressure, ex-President Goodluck Jonathan signed the Same-Sex Marriage (Prohibition) Act in January 2014, prescribing between 10 and 14 years in prison for cohabitation between same-sex sexual partners, public show of same-sex relationship, registration, operation, or participation in gay clubs, societies, and organisation, amongst others. However, the Biden Presidency has threatened “swift and meaningful” responses, including financial sanctions against countries found guilty of human rights abuses of LGBTQI+ persons. Video: Fani-Kayode has joined APC The governor of #KogiState, Yahaya Bello, has announced that a controversial politician and former minister of Aviation, Femi Fani-Kayode, has joined the ruling All Progressives Congress, APC. On Wednesday the Nation published the video of the governor addressing a crowd, saying Mr Fani-Kayode, who is a foundation member of APC, has rejoined the party. Mr Fani-Kayode was the director of publicity in 2015 Peoples Democratic Party, #PDP, campaign council. He is one of the most consistent and acerbic critic of the ruling party. On Monday, Mr Fani-Kayode’s pictures with the governor of Kogi State, #YahayaBello and subsequently with the governor of Yobe State and chairman of the APC caretaker committee, Mai Mala Buni, sparked speculations that the controversial politician was planning to defect to the APC. VIDEO: Herdsmen crisis:Wole Soyinka urges President Buhari to address Nigerians Nobel Laureate, Prof. Wole Soyinka, has urged the President, Major General Muhammadu Buhari (retd.), to address Nigerians and make it known publicly that he does not support the criminal activities of some herdsmen in parts of the country. Soyinka spoke in an interview with BBC News Pidgin. He warned against another civil war if nothing was quickly done to address the herdsmen crisis rocking the nation. Soyinka said, “We may enter a phase of serial skirmishes which may get more and more violent and develop – I hate to use the word – may develop into a civil war and a very untidy and messy one at that. That is my biggest fear.” Oyo and Ondo states have been in the eye of the storm lately over security challenges and the moves to check the activities of killer herdsmen. A popular Yoruba rights activist, Sunday Adeyemo, well known as Sunday Igboho, had issued a seven-day notice to quit to herdsmen accused of crimes in the Ibarapa area of Oyo and enforced same. Governor Rotimi Akerdolu of Ondo State also said herdsmen must register with the state government or vacate the state forest reserves. Commenting on the herdsmen crisis, Soyinka said there should be civil mobilisation now that the herdsmen crisis is at the doorstep of the people of the South-West region. He said, “If we keep waiting for this to be centrally handled, we are all going to become, if not already, slaves in our land. That for me is intolerable and unacceptable.” “We are here to live in dignity (but) right now, our dignity is being rubbished,” he lamented. On what should constitute the speech of the President to the nation on the herdsmen crisis, the Nobel Laureate said Buhari should “address the nation in very stern, unambiguous terms”. He said the President should say openly: “Yes, I know I am the patron of the cattlerearers association etc. I’m a cattle rancher myself, it is a business and I run my business on business terms. I do not run my business by raping, by displacing, by torturing. “I do not run my business by occupying lands that does not belong to me and I am warning all business people in the food commodity, all you cattlerearers, whatever comes to you for illegal occupation or trespassing on other people’s property is your business. “And I am ordering the army, all the security forces to back citizens’ efforts in flushing you out. VIDEO: Drama, Confusion, tears as pastor refuses to wed couple for arriving 5 minutes late There was a mild drama at the Fulfilling World Foundation Church, Port Harcourt, Rivers State, on Saturday as the senior pastor, Essay Oggory, refused to wed a couple after they arrived 5 minutes late to the venue of their wedding. In a viral video, the pastor can be seen walking out on the couple. Families, friends, and well-wishers of the couple, who were at the church for the occasion, were left in shock. The bride cried uncontrollably as she could not believe what was happening. However, the pastor was said to have returned to wed the couple after much pressure on the condition that the wedding will happen in his office and not the church auditorium. The couple rejected the condition and were seen leaving the church compound in their cars. AKWA IBOM GOVERNMENT HOLD VALEDICTORY SESSION, IMMORTALIZES LATE FORMER GOVERNOR IDONGESIT NKANGA https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=QtRl9ET8qbQ The Akwa Ibom State Executive Council has resolved that the new Ring Road 3 dual carriage way be named after the state's first indigenous Military Governor, Air Commodore Idongesit Nkanga. At a special valedictory session held in honour of the departed former Governor at the Exco Chambers Government House, Uyo Friday, Governor Emmanuel described the late Military Governor as a close friend, confidante and brother. He said Nkanga remained a reference point for patriotism and statesmanship and that his departure has left a vacuum difficult to be filled. Describing Nkanga as a reference point for patriotism, statesmanship and forthrightness, Mr Emmanuel said, "Air Commodore Idongesit Nkanga, Rtd, was a gentleman, an officer, a nationalist, a good Christian, my political Director-General, my personal friend, leader of Ibibio nation goodnight”. Bemoaning his sudden passage, the Governor said Nkanga was a coordinating force in Akwa Ibom State and the entire South-South region. “Words will fail me to describe how we grieved when we lost this Idongesit of our time, it took time for the void and disbelief to be filled with the acknowledgement that our icon now belongs to the ages and not with us anymore. "That was when we realized how much he meant to us, how much we identified with him, how much he had become part of the Akwa Ibom dream, we feel a collective sense of deprivation because he still had a lot to contribute”. The ceremony featured tributes from the Deputy Governor, Mr. Moses Ekpo, Speaker, Akwa Ibom State House of Assembly, Rt.(Hon) Aniekan Bassey, Senator Helen Esuene as well as former State Chief Judge, Rtd.Justice Idongesit Ntem-Isua and Chief Obot Etukafia who both had served as commissioners under the deceased. The occasion climaxed with the adorning of the casket of the late Military Governor with the national and state flags and observation of a minute of silence in his honour.
